The Gemini IRAF task gemcrspec uses the L.A.Cosmic algorithm written by P.G. van Dokkum to remove cosmic rays. Specifically, it makes use of the lacos_spec.cl implementation of the algorithm. If you followed the instructions in the chapter on installation, you should be ready to go.

If you are not attending a live tutorial and are willing to wait, you can run the commands below. Obviously, if you are using this tutorial to reduce your own data, you do need to run the commands below.

Let us make sure it is installed correctly by doing a little smoke test.

lpar lacos_spec

If that worked and you saw the list of input parameters, you can proceed. If not, you need to go back to the chapter on software installation and follow the L.A.Cosmic instructions at the end of that chapter.

imdelete('xbrg@sci.lis')

for sci in iraf.type('sci.lis', Stdout=1):
    sci = sci.strip()
    iraf.gemcrspec('brg'+sci, 'xbrg'+sci, logfile='crrej.log', \
              key_gain='GAIN', key_ron='RDNOISE', xorder=9, \
              yorder=-1, sigclip=4.5, sigfrac=0.5, objlim=1., \
              niter=4, verbose='yes', fl_vardq='yes')
